Home
last modified time | relevance | path

Searched refs:patchRHS (Results 1 – 3 of 3) sorted by relevance

/petsc/src/snes/impls/patch/
H A Dsnespatch.c94 PetscCall(VecDuplicate(patch->patchRHS, &patch->patchResidual)); in PCSetUp_PATCH_Nonlinear()
111 static PetscErrorCode PCApply_PATCH_Nonlinear(PC pc, PetscInt i, Vec patchRHS, Vec patchUpdate) in PCApply_PATCH_Nonlinear() argument
130 patchRHS->map->n = n; in PCApply_PATCH_Nonlinear()
131 patchRHS->map->N = n; in PCApply_PATCH_Nonlinear()
135 PetscCall(SNESSolve((SNES)patch->solver[i], patchRHS, patchUpdate)); in PCApply_PATCH_Nonlinear()
/petsc/include/petsc/private/
H A Dpcpatchimpl.h91 …Vec patchRHS, patchUpdate; /* Work vectors for RHS and solution on each patc… member
/petsc/src/ksp/pc/impls/patch/
H A Dpcpatch.c2635 PetscCall(VecCreateSeq(PETSC_COMM_SELF, maxDof, &patch->patchRHS)); in PCSetUp_PATCH()
2636 PetscCall(VecSetUp(patch->patchRHS)); in PCSetUp_PATCH()
2658 PetscCall(VecSet(patch->patchRHS, 1.0)); in PCSetUp_PATCH()
2659 …PetscCall(PCPatch_ScatterLocal_Private(pc, i + pStart, patch->patchRHS, patch->dof_weights, ADD_VA… in PCSetUp_PATCH()
2819 …PetscCall(PCPatch_ScatterLocal_Private(pc, i + pStart, patch->localRHS, patch->patchRHS, INSERT_VA… in PCApply_PATCH()
2820 PetscCall((*patch->applysolver)(pc, i, patch->patchRHS, patch->patchUpdate)); in PCApply_PATCH()
2920 PetscCall(VecDestroy(&patch->patchRHS)); in PCReset_PATCH()